Non-Emergency Medical Transportation Technician
Provide transportation for patients/clients to and from hospitals, convalescent facilities, dialysis centers, rehabilitation centers, medical offices and their private residences on time in a safe, secure and professional manner and in Accordance with (IAW) established Policies and Procedures and training protocols.
Essential duties include the following (other duties may be assigned):
- Transport patients and clients utilizing company vehicles on time in a safe and professional manner.
- Effectively communicate with dispatch regarding scheduled transports, all status updates and able to receive additional instructions.
- Effectively participate in professional, stimulating and pleasant dialogue with patients, their family members and our clients.
- Maintain a professional public image and attitude in regard to clients, visitors and co‐workers at all times.
- Complete daily vehicle pre‐trip and post-trip inspections and maintain vehicle cleanliness.
- Assist clients and patients as needed to safely complete the transfer.
- Must understand instructions in English (both written and spoken).
- Must be able to accurately complete activity logs vehicle reports.
- Must be able to understand and operate GPS devices, 2-way radios, and cell phones.
- Comfortable using computers or tablets to document patient transports.
Qualifications:
- Must be 18 years of age or older to apply.
- Must have a clean driving record.
- Enthusiastic and customer service focused.
- Able to work both indoors and outdoors in all kinds of weather conditions.
- Available during some holidays and weekends.
- Must be able to do considerable kneeling, bending, and heavy lifting up to 65lbs.
- Able to push a patient in a wheelchair up to 500lbs.
- Autonomy and initiative is required while doing transports, especially when dealing with patients or family members.
